WebMar 29, 2024 · Fluids. Fluids must be given carefully. In some cases, drinking water may cause a cat with an upset stomach to vomit, further dehydrating him. Giving the cat ice chips to lick may help. Unflavored Pedialyte can be given via dropper very slowly to cats that are at risk of becoming dehydrated. WebIn some cases, the incisors and canine (fang) teeth can be spared. Antibiotics and pain medications are used to control bacterial infection and pain. Stomatitis resolves in approximately 80 percent of patients following full mouth extractions. Some cases of stomatitis, though, will persist, and additional anti-inflammatory medications will be ...
